Hi,
I have purchased an ASRock Beebox N3150. I have replaced the 2GB RAM, which came with the unit with 2x 4GB SODIMMS. I was hoping to get away with the onboard 32GB storage, but this was becoming an issue, so I purcahsed an AData 128gn mSATA drive. I have a Windows 10 USB Installation drive. I put this into the Beebox and start going through the installation process. When I go to select the mSATA drive in the list, it won't let me install Windows on this device and showed an error something along the lines of "We couldn't create a new partition or locate an existing one. For more information see the setup log files". Research indicated that Windows 10 hates a pile of partitions and on the existing onboard storage there were about 4 partitions. So I deleted these. The issue persisted. Follwojng other advise, I dropped into a command prompt and using DiskPart, I selected the drived, cleaned it, created an NTFS partition and set it as the active partition. This time when I went through the installation process, a new message presented itself: "Windows can't be installed on Drive 0 Partition 1 (Clcik here for more information)" When you click on the More Information, I get a message saying Windows can't be installed onto my selected location and provided the error code: 0x80300001 Apparently this error code often shows when the Windows 10 USB Installation drive does have the right drivers for your device. When I go to the ASRock website there are INF drivers, but they are a Windows executable - the raw files aren't there. Where too from here!?!? |
